Neither smartphone nor app-phone: net-phone

Recently David Pogue suggested smartphones like the iPhone should be called app-phone instead. I think focussing on the apps is wrong. For me, the thing that the iPhone does better than most other phones is internet access. The iphone is a net-phone. It is your mobile internet terminal. But it’s more than that, it’s also the device that you use to feed data into the internet: location, direction, pictures, etc.

Modern smartphones are your connector to the internet. Most applications that are installed are user interfaces to services on the internet. SOA UI’s as some would call them. Internet access is the killer app for these devices, talking is only secondary. So i suggest we call them net-phones.
